The Bodbe Monastery, just a short distance from Sighnaghi, is a place of profound spiritual significance. As you wander through its tranquil gardens, the stories of Saint Nino and the spread of Christianity in Georgia resonate with a timeless grace. The nuns’ dedication to preserving this sacred site is evident in the meticulously maintained grounds, inviting visitors to pause and reflect on the deeper connections between history, faith, and the natural world.
